Output 54acc60ae368c014272560658d4052d66d92d84d62e9e0e7b819add4393cd1b3:0

value
994481
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ce73ab0e800d37eee91eb31eceda602dd6b5b70 OP_EQUAL
address
3AAF6HN1inzSGsXBwhG4R3J9kwFRWhimPu
transaction
54acc60ae368c014272560658d4052d66d92d84d62e9e0e7b819add4393cd1b3
confirmations
360112
spent
true